Bone Reconstruction is a treatment option for patients experiencing substantial bone loss or structural damage due to trauma, complex fractures, infection, tumors, or congenital conditions. Depending on the patient's needs, surgeons may use bone grafts, specialised implants, fixation systems, or bone transport techniques to reconstruct the affected area. Comprehensive evaluation and imaging before surgery help determine the appropriate approach, while post-treatment rehabilitation supports healing, strength, and mobility.
